Bristol is ready for Carter’s Digital Britain…

by Stephen Hilton 15/06/2009 in Bristol

On the eve of Lord Carter’s final Digital Britain Report our latest city data shows that Bristol’s residents are ready and waiting… 3 in every 4 are already regular Internet users who have used the Web in the last week.

PM announces New Educational Technology Allowances

by Kevin 23/09/2008 in People

In his keynote speech to the Labour Party Conference in Manchester this afternoon Gordon Brown unveiled a £300m scheme aimed at ensuring every child in the country has access to a PC and connectivity at home.
